你查询的IP:[117.24.20.176]  地理位置:中国–福建–泉州

最新查询116.95.234.155 120.32.219.50 221.12.207.235 123.112.222.67 121.192.222.67 121.56.241.209 122.8.106.104 121.248.157.93 218.64.35.163 117.24.20.176 202.122.112.112 202.192.184.249 61.232.67.118 121.58.144.236 202.189.80.3 123.52.205.200 116.116.125.222 221.14.225.232 116.252.149.129 122.96.187.223 61.87.192.170 218.104.209.212 116.60.28.85 124.20.255.255 117.124.89.196 202.91.224.123 125.32.232.102 202.14.236.138 58.99.128.5 119.78.47.220 124.243.192.54